A Roth IRA calculator is a retirement-planning tool that estimates how tax-free retirement money could compound over time inside a Roth IRA. Unlike a traditional IRA estimate that often focuses on the tax deduction up front, a Roth IRA projection is mainly about how much after-tax money might be available later without future tax on qualified withdrawals.
That makes this tool useful for comparing contribution strategies, setting a retirement-balance target, and checking whether your planned annual contribution is likely to support your long-term retirement-income goal. In future-balance mode, the calculator starts with your current Roth IRA balance, applies the expected annual return each year, then adds the annual contribution for that year. If you enter a contribution-increase percentage, each later year's contribution rises from the prior year so you can model gradually increasing savings.
In required-contribution mode, the tool works backward from a target retirement balance and solves for the annual contribution needed to get there. It also estimates an inflation-adjusted balance, a rough tax-free monthly retirement-income amount using your chosen withdrawal rule, and a taxable-equivalent comparison based on your assumed retirement tax rate. The default example uses a long-term Roth IRA growth path from age 30 to 65 with ongoing annual contributions and a modest contribution increase, which makes it useful for QA and for visualizing how contributions and compounding combine over time.
In this example, starting with $18,000.00 at age 30 and contributing $7,000.00 annually until age 65 produces a projected Roth IRA balance of $1,406,915.34. Using a 4.0% withdrawal rule, that supports about $4,689.72 per month in tax-free retirement income.
